Senate 0238: Relating to Procuring a Person for Prostitution [SPSC]
|
S238 GENERAL BILL by Fasano Procuring a Person for Prostitution [SPSC]; Provides that a person who is 18 years of age or older commits a felony of the first degree if the victim of such offense is 16 years of age or younger and is 5 or more years younger than the person committing the violation. Provides criminal penalties, etc. EFFECTIVE DATE: 07/01/2010. 10/05/09 SENATE Filed 12/09/09 SENATE Referred to Criminal Justice; Criminal and Civil Justice Appropriations 03/02/10 SENATE Introduced, referred to Criminal Justice; Criminal and Civil Justice Appropriations -SJ 00026 03/18/10 SENATE Withdrawn from Criminal Justice; Criminal and Civil Justice Appropriations -SJ 00268; Withdrawn from further consideration -SJ 00268
